Q: Is 10,684,668 a Prime Number?
A: No, 10,684,668 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 10684668 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 521 1,042 1,563 1,709 2,084 3,126 3,418 5,127 6,252 6,836 10,254 20,508 890,389 1,780,778 2,671,167 3,561,556 5,342,334 and 10,684,668, with no remainder.
Since 10,684,668 cannot be divided by just 1 and 10,684,668, it is not a prime number.
